    Overview

    Is a traditional island town occupying a beautiful location and providing a dramatic moment for all drivers as the main island road ME-1 meanders through a very picturesque and narrow gap in the hills. Ferreries is surrounded by beautiful hills and countryside and spectacular valleys and history. A great start point for scenic walks,cycling and horse riding.

    There is a regular bus service to Ciutadella and Mahon, with connections on route for other destinations.

    Algendar Gorge

    One of the most spectacular gorges on the island. About 6 kilometers long starting just outside Ferreries stretching to the south coast behind Cala Galdana where the river meets the sea. The easiest access point is at Cala Galdana. The gorge is cut out of one of the soft limestone plateaus so typical of the island.

    San Àgueda Castle

    Due to its political symbolism the castle was destroyed and abandoned by the re-occupying Kings of Aragon, but it remains one of the island most attractive walks with great views at the summit.

    Built circa 1230 a castle contructed by the Moorish occupiers (the name is based on the Arabic name "Sen Agaiz") for defence sitting on top of the island's better vantage points on the island. Reached by a 45 min. climb up an ancient path which is in places was an old Roman road ( over two thousand years old ) - the views from the top are superb.

    Like many ancient sites Santa Àgueda has sprung many rich legends and myths including buried biblical treasures.

    On the ME-1 between Ferrerias and Ciutadella. Take the turn for Els Alocs and continue until you reach an abandoned building. This marks the start of the path to the top of the hill.

    Ciutadella

    An taste of former elegant times with fine old spanish palaces, moorish influences, a wonderful old centre and a charming little harbour. Ciutadella was the original capital of the island lying at the western edge of the island looking out to its bigger neighbour Mallorca. A superb contrast to the beach and holiday resort. Great atmosphere and shopping and a place to wander the pedestrianised old city and its many narrow streets with hidden shops and Cafe treats. Also competes with Mahon for the title of the best music bars and venues on the island. The scene for the spectacular Sant Joan festival in June, when stunning native black horses parade through the streets and the brave try to "touch the horses' heart" as it rears in front of them.

    Cala Morells

    A small quiet fishing village resort on the north west coast set in dramatic rocky coastlines. Best known for the extensive man made (Bronze and Iron ages) cave dwellings nearby that give a real sense of cave "living" ( though many caves were also for burial ). Some are sophisticated with central roof columns and 'windows'. Some are obviously younger and larger, cut with more advanced metal tools, but the smaller older ones gives a view into another world. A good place to combine with a visit to the beautiful virgin beach of Algaiarens and walks through the very attractive valleys of Vall de Algaiarens.
